Cask at The Fountain, Walsall. Poured a clear golden brown with a thick long-lived white head. The aroma is rich and malty. The flavour is medium bitter and much the same as the aroma. The hoppy bitterness sits nicely on the palate. This is a great smooth session bitter rather than a Christmas ale. I’d order a second pint so it must be good!
